I just riveted a piece of Velcro long enough to reach the back cushion. I also place some Velcro tape to the back to keep it out of the way when not in use
 
I use something similar to BobM, but I used 3 small rounded head screws and braided twine. Secured the twine to the back of the roll over couch with a screw and put the other screws under the lids. I left a gap under the 2 lid screws and made loops in the twine to slip over the screw heads.
